Penguins Shut Out Golden Knights 5-0

About this episode

Pittsburgh Penguins dominate Vegas Golden Knights, securing a 5-0 shutout win. Arturs Silovs secures his second shutout of the season with 22 saves. Penguins score three goals in the second period, with Bryan Rust, Ben Kindel, and Justin Brazeau each scoring once and adding an assist. Erik Karlsson dishes out two helpers. Penguins improve to 31-15-13, on a hot streak with 10 wins in 14 games. Vegas goalie Adin Hill makes 18 saves in the loss. Golden Knights drop two of their first three games on a five-game road trip.
